DocGo Inc is a provider of last-mile mobile health services and integrated medical mobility solutions. The company uses its care delivery platform to provide mobile health services, virtual care management, and ambulance services. It has two reporting segments: Mobile Health Services and Transportation Services. A majority of its revenue is generated from the Mobile Health Services segment, which includes various healthcare services performed at homes, offices, and other locations and event services such as on-site healthcare support at sporting events and concerts. Geographically, the company generates a majority of its revenue from the United States and the rest from the United Kingdom.
aTyr Pharma Inc is a clinical-stage biotechnology company focused on developing therapies for fibrosis and inflammatory conditions. Its research leverages tRNA synthetase biology to identify potential therapeutic targets. The company's discovery platform uses a proprietary library of domains derived from tRNA synthetases to explore signaling pathways. Its flagship clinical candidate, efzofitimod, is a novel biologic immunomodulatory in development for the treatment of interstitial lung disease (ILD).
